5. Big Eyes

The Buzz: A Tim Burton movie with no Johnny Depp or Helena Bonham Carter? Big Eyes follows Walter Keane (Christoph Waltz), the apparent artist of the famous paintings of big-eyed children that swept the U.S. in the 1950s. However, it turned out that his timid wife, Margaret (Amy Adams), was the real artist, leading to a bitter court battle between the two after she claimed authorship. Big Eyes is another movie avoiding festivals, so there won't be any major word on the movie for a while, though spies who have seen the film suggest it's very much Ed Wood-inspired, which can only be a good thing. Oscar Predictions: The movie could really go either way, though it's certainly possible that a Best Picture nomination could be on the cards, along with Best Director (Burton), and Best Original Screenplay, though the safest bets are Best Actress (Adams), Best Production Design and Best Costume Design. Crafts wins are by far the most likely Oscar glory in the movie's future, though if Adams can fend off the likes of Julianne Moore, she could finally win her first Oscar on her sixth nomination.
